WESTLAKE, LOS ANGELES (KABC) — Gallons of rushing water flooded an intersection in the Westlake area following yet another water main break Thursday morning.

The severe flooding was seen at the intersection of Beverly and North Occidental boulevards. Video from the scene showed the street inundated with water as it rushed around cars.

Los Angeles Department of Water and Power crews responded to the scene around 4:30 a.m. but additional details were not available.
